Genomically-Directed Monotherapy

**Semantic type:** Therapeutic or Preventive Procedure

**Definition:** The use of genomic sequencing to direct cancer therapy. A profile of the DNA and RNA expressed by a patient's tumor is obtained and used to select known therapies that will exploit the specific genetic defects found in that tumor.
